If I'm trading in a PS3 ($45 value) but I don't have a Dualshock 3, only a generic third party controller, will Gamestop dock me the full value of a used controller ($45), effectively giving me $0 for my system?

I exclusively trade in 3rd party controllers with my console trade ins. Question here for me is that not all ps3 models came with dualshock 3 controllers so I'm not sure if one needs to be traded in with it...

Pretty sure GS won't (isn't supposed to) take in any PS3 w/o an official DualShock 3. Only systems I know of they would take with 3rd party controller are original style 360's with a wired controller (plus you lose about $5-$10 in trade value) & maybe Wii's.
